
Reya is a trading-optimized Layer 2 network that uses a based zero-knowledge rollup architecture to deliver high-speed execution, verifiable settlement, and seamless interoperability with Ethereum’s decentralised finance ecosystem.
Modern onchain trading faces a fundamental bottleneck: general-purpose blockchains are not designed to support the speed, predictability, and reliability required by active markets. Ethereum provides unmatched security and decentralisation, yet its base layer cannot deliver sub-millisecond confirmations or handle the order flow required for high-frequency strategies without introducing confirmation delays or fee spikes.
Many projects have attempted to address this by launching alternative Layer 1s or single-sequencer rollups. These approaches typically sacrifice decentralisation, neutrality, or economic security. A high-performance trading environment that relies on a single sequencer or a small validator set becomes vulnerable to censorship, downtime, or inconsistent ordering.
Reya approaches the problem differently. Instead of treating trading as a generic smart contract workload, it introduces a specialised execution layer designed around the microstructure of markets while remaining tightly aligned with Ethereum’s validator set. The result is a trading environment that seeks to match traditional exchange performance without compromising on verifiability or decentralisation.
Reya operates as a trading-specific based rollup - a design in which Ethereum validators play a central role in sequencing, while dedicated execution nodes handle high-speed transaction processing and proof generation.
A based rollup is a Layer 2 system that integrates directly with Ethereum’s proposer set rather than relying on an independent sequencer. Ethereum validators are responsible for block construction and can delegate execution responsibilities to designated nodes following a pre-established schedule.

Reya uses this model to anchor high-speed trading logic directly to Ethereum’s settlement guarantees.
Reya uses specialised execution nodes that process orders, run the trading engine, and produce zero-knowledge proofs of the resulting state transitions. These nodes issue two levels of transaction acknowledgment:
Pre-confirmation:
A near-instant execution receipt provided by the execution node.
This gives traders deterministic feedback on order acceptance with sub-millisecond latency.
Finalization:
Batched transactions are submitted to Ethereum, where they are included in an L1 block.
Once finalised, trades gain the full settlement guarantees of Ethereum.
The dual-confirmation model allows Reya to combine the speed of specialised execution with the credibility of Ethereum settlement.

Reya’s architecture is purpose-built to support markets with high volume and low latency requirements.
Reya employs a custom trading engine implemented in Rust. The engine is designed for determinism and is cross-compiled into zero-knowledge circuits. This allows the network to generate validity proofs for each state transition, ensuring that order execution is provably correct.
The system generates proofs asynchronously, enabling execution nodes to validate trades quickly while the final proof is prepared in parallel. Once included in an L1 block, the new state becomes canonical.
This ensures:
Because sequencing authority ties directly into Ethereum validators, Reya maintains synchronous composability with the L1. Assets and positions can interoperate with other Ethereum protocols without needing asynchronous bridges or trust-minimised intermediaries.
This design differentiates Reya from ecosystems that rely on separate validator networks or bespoke settlement layers.

rUSD serves as the base liquidity token within the protocol. It is primarily used in liquidity staking and in mechanisms that support collateralisation and liquidity flows.

sREYA represents staked REYA used in governance and protocol alignment. Holding sREYA grants additional rights and may provide enhanced benefits across the trading ecosystem.

Reya’s design offers several notable advantages:
Alignment with Ethereum:
By leveraging Ethereum validators, the rollup avoids the centralisation risks of independent sequencers.
High-speed execution:
Sub-millisecond pre-confirmations and a purpose-built trading engine support real-time market interactions.
ZK-verified settlement:
All state transitions are backed by zero-knowledge proofs for transparent correctness.
Risk isolation across accounts:
Professional-grade margin segmentation within a self-custodial system.
Capital-efficient stablecoin model:
srUSD combines yield generation with collateral utility.
Synchronous composability:
Direct interoperability with Ethereum DeFi without asynchronous bridging.
Despite its strengths, Reya has risks that users should consider:
Execution node centralisation:
Until node rotation is fully implemented, the system relies on a limited set of operators.
External DA dependency:
Order data relies on an external data availability layer, which introduces a new operational dependency.
Complexity of ZK systems:
Zero-knowledge circuits for trading engines are still an evolving domain and may introduce unexpected performance or security considerations.
Ecosystem maturity:
As a newer execution layer, Reya must build liquidity, trading volume, and developer adoption.
Regulatory considerations:
Perpetual markets and synthetic RWA exposure may face legal scrutiny depending on jurisdiction.

What is a based rollup?
A based rollup is a Layer 2 system where Ethereum validators play a direct role in sequencing transactions, reducing dependency on external sequencers and improving alignment with L1 security.
How does Reya differ from other Layer 2 networks?
Reya is tailored specifically for trading. It uses a custom trading engine, a dual-confirmation model, and a data architecture designed for high-frequency order flow.
Is the REYA token required to trade?
No. Trading does not require REYA, although the token participates in governance and protocol alignment mechanisms.
How does srUSD earn yield?
srUSD accrues yield automatically through protocol fees and liquidity mechanisms. The balance remains constant while its value increases through periodic revaluation.
Is Reya fully decentralised today?
Not yet. The system is progressing through a staged roadmap toward full execution node rotation and decentralised operator participation.
